<pre>Steps to reproduce:
* Get some content in the timeline
* Switch to rendering frames view
* Mousedown in the ruler and drag left or right
Expected:
* pie chart should live-update as I drag the selection
Actual:
* pie chart doesn't update until selection is committed (i.e., mouseup)
Notes:
It would seem that we don't create an actual selection until the range is committed, so none of the UI knows to update. In the UI, there is no difference between a real and provisional selection.
Since all of the UI live-updates when panning an already created selection, I don't think this will cause a meaningful perf regression, except in one case. Selecting a range when a busy ScriptTimelineView will be choppy until we fix other filtering/render performance problems.</pre>
